What is a translation in geometry?
Back
A translation is a transformation that moves every point of a shape the same distance in a specified direction.

How do you translate a shape two units to the left?
Back
To translate a shape two units to the left, subtract 2 from the x-coordinate of each point of the shape.

What is the effect of translating a shape downwards?
Back
Translating a shape downwards involves subtracting from the y-coordinate of each point of the shape.

What is a reflection in geometry?
Back
A reflection is a transformation that flips a shape over a line, creating a mirror image.

What is the line of reflection for a reflection across the x-axis?
Back
The line of reflection for a reflection across the x-axis is the x-axis itself, where the y-coordinates of points are negated.

What happens to the coordinates of a point (x, y) when reflected across the y-axis?
Back
When reflected across the y-axis, the coordinates of the point (x, y) become (-x, y).

What is the difference between a translation and a reflection?
Back
A translation moves a shape without changing its orientation, while a reflection flips a shape over a line, changing its orientation.
